Annual Gynecological Exam

An annual gynecological exam is a critical component for a woman’s overall health. Many conditions have the potential to affect a woman’s health without showing obvious signs of being present. These conditions include several types of cancers that can threaten a woman’s reproductive health and life.

What is Included in an Annual Gynecological Exam?

An annual gynecological exam includes a pap smear and examination of a woman’s pelvis and breasts. The doctor may ask about your sexual history and menstrual cycles. The visit may also include additional screenings and vaccinations, depending on your personal health history.

When Should You Start Annual Gynecological Exams?

Women should start having this exam at around 15 years of age. The wellness visits around this age focus mainly on reproductive education. Pap smears and breast exams are typically not part of an annual gynecological exam until a woman turns 21 years old.
